As of September 2026, Richmond Heights Estates in Miami, FL has 3 homes for sale.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-12, 9 recorded sales closed at a median of $515,000, $347 per square foot, a median 46 days on market, sellers accepting 97% of original asking (+15% versus the prior year). Homes listed or recently sold were built 1959–2019. At the median price and Miami-Dade County's FY2025-26 rate of 17.59 mills, annual property tax runs about $9,060 ($8,350 with the full homestead exemption).

What's Actually Driving Price Here
With a market heat score of 32, Richmond Heights Estates sits well off the pace of a competitive, multiple-offer market. Buyers generally have room to negotiate on terms and timeline, and sellers who understand this posture price to the condition of their home rather than to hope.
The $339.66 per-square-foot median is the number to lean on when evaluating a specific listing against the broader pool. Two homes at the same square footage can land far apart on final price depending on updates, systems, and finish — in a market without shared amenities pulling buyer interest, the property itself has to carry the case.
